  • Marché Provençal in Le Muy: Local Delights

    Marché Provençal in Le Muy takes place at Allées Victor Hugo, in Le Muy. The public schedule is January 1 to December 31, 2026. Its regional value is practical and everyday: producers, artisans and regular marketgoers keep the open-air market as part of local life. In the charming streets of Le Muy, colorful facades reflect the light of Provence, creating a picturesque backdrop for the Marché Provençal. This Sunday market is one of the largest in the Var, attracting locals and visitors who come to experience a rich variety of fabrics, scents, and flavors. Each week, stalls burst with products that celebrate the region’s agricultural heritage and artisanal craftsmanship.
